• Daily Devotion — May 30 | Mark 12:30 (NKJV)

    Wholehearted Devotion

    Mark chapter 12 records a conversation where a scribe asked Jesus which commandment was the greatest. In response, Jesus pointed back to the foundation of all true faith and obedience. The greatest commandment is to love the Lord your God with every part of your being.

    Jesus mentions the heart, soul, mind, and strength to show that love for God is meant to involve the entire person. The heart represents desires and affections. The soul speaks of the inner life and spiritual devotion. The mind involves thoughts and understanding. Strength refers to actions, energy, and daily living.

    This command reveals that Christianity is not merely about outward religion or occasional worship. God desires complete devotion. Loving Him is meant to shape every thought, decision, attitude, and action.

    True love for God flows from recognizing who He is and responding to His goodness and grace. It is not forced or divided. It is wholehearted.

    For believers today this verse challenges us to examine whether God truly holds first place in our lives. Many things compete for attention, affection, and loyalty, but Jesus teaches that loving God must remain the highest priority.

    When love for God becomes central, every other area of life begins to align properly.

  • Daily Verse — May 30 | Mark 12:30 (NKJV)

    And you shall love the Lord your God with all your heart, with all your soul, with all your mind, and with all your strength.’ This is the first commandment.
